1. Two-Toned Walls

Paint can have a significant impact on the overall look of your room. It can either transform your space to open it up or make it look smaller and closed off. All of this depends on what colors of paint you use and how far up you paint your walls.

A popular interior design technique is to paint your walls in two different tones. Using two different colors achieves a stylish look and gives you the opportunity to experiment however you want.

There are several color combinations you can opt for. Soft greens, pinks and blues are a great way to create the feel of airy space. In comparison, harsher browns and reds are great for painting the backs of firewalls or TV lounges – places where you need to radiate warmth.

3. Customize Your Lighting

Lighting is another key component that plays a major role in dictating the essence of the room. Using bright and harsh lighting evokes strong emotion and energy whereas dimmer lights help provide a calming effect.

Moreover, warm lighting in the tones of red and yellow provides a cozier atmosphere whereas cooler lights with a white and blue hue have more energy. While there is no such thing as a perfect combination of lights for a room, it can be helpful to install a variety of options in your room. You can also use color-changing bulbs to adjust as the mood desires.

Depending on the time of the day you can adjust the brightness and hue. For a cozier room however, it is recommended to keep overhead lighting at bay and natural lighting as a priority.

4. Add Family Photos

Adding family or personal photos to the layout of the wall helps make it feel more personalized and inviting. Thiscan help calm anxiety, alleviate mood and add a homely touch to the room.

If you’re planning to do so, it can be helpful to choose photos that show an important milestone or fragment of your life. These can be family photos, wedding photos, candids, collages showcasing various achievements or pictures from your childhood.

Before placing the photos, choose matching frames and interchanging the sizes of each frame. The key to achieving the best photo layout is balance.

5. Texture

The importance of texture in interior design can’t be overlooked. Texture is an umbrella term referring to the outer appearance of any object such as rugs, carpets, wood or stone that make a space appear more interesting and lively.

Textured décor items provide a 3D feel to the room and prevent it from looking flat. Invest in a soft and light rug if you want to make your room cozier. They’re a great way to add texture to the room without making it look overcrowded. You can either get a plush rug for maximum texture or a patterned rug for those that favor patterns and color.

6. Accessorize

Adding in a bunch of throw pillows, ornaments, vases and plants may seem unnecessary to many homeowners, but it adds character. Depending on how you place these items, they can add a pop of color, style, and make your space look comfier.

For starters, try buying throw pillows with multicolored covers. You can easily enhance the look of your sofas and beds by throwing these cushions onto them. While there’s no set number of pillows you can add, you can always mix and match the styles to see what fits best.

If you’re a plant lover, it can be helpful placing tall potted plants in the corners of each room. It helps make the space look more welcoming and livelier as well.

7. Don’t Forget Your Windows

While most people consider this irrelevant, placing curtains on your windows can take your room’s appearance to the next level. Curtains help add dimension and flow to a room, making the room look more open and breathable.

Depending on the colors and patterns you choose, you can drastically change the aura of your home. If you’re feeling frisky, you can even add in curtains with shapes and animal prints to bring your room to life.
